Introduction

In an era where data-driven decision-making is critical, organizations are increasingly turning to business intelligence tools to harness their data's power. This case study explores a thorough Power BI control panel development job undertaken by a mid-sized retail business, Retail Innovations Inc., seeking to improve its analytical capabilities and enhance sales performance.



Background

Retail Innovations Inc. had actually been facing challenges in envisioning its vast range of sales data efficiently. The business operated numerous retail outlets and an online shop, creating a substantial quantity of data daily. However, the existing ad-hoc reporting system was troublesome, resulting in delays in deriving actionable insights. The management recognized the need for an incorporated, user-friendly dashboard that could offer real-time Data Visualization Consultant visualization to empower their decision-making procedures.



Objectives Data Visualization Consultant

The primary objectives of the Power BI control panel development were as follows:



Real-time Data Access: Enable stakeholders to access and analyze sales data in real-time.
User-Friendly Interface: Ensure that the dashboard is easy and user-friendly to navigate for users with differing technical abilities.
Enhanced Data Visualization: Utilize visual components like charts, graphs, and maps to represent data meaningfully.
Key Performance Indicators (KPIs): Identify and track necessary KPIs to measure sales efficiency efficiently.
Scalability: Design a solution that could accommodate future data sets and analytical needs.

Implementation Process

Step 1: Requirement Gathering


The Power BI advancement procedure started with comprehensive conversations with key stakeholders including the sales team, IT department, and upper management. An in-depth requirements document was crafted, recording insights into what metrics and visualizations would be most advantageous.


Step 2: Data Preparation


Drawing from multiple sources, consisting of the business's ERP system, online sales platform, and client relationship management (CRM) system, the data group performed an extensive data cleansing and transformation stage. Power Query was used to balance various data formats and get rid of redundancies, ensuring high data quality.


Step 3: Dashboard Design


The style stage concentrated on developing a appealing and interactive user interface. The advancement group used Power BI's drag-and-drop features to create numerous visualizations. The dashboard was segmented into different tabs covering essential areas such as:



Sales Overview: Displaying total sales, sales by area, and comparisons against previous periods.
Product Performance: Highlighting top-selling products and categories, together with inventory levels.
Customer Insights: Analyzing customer demographics, purchase habits, and loyalty metrics.

Step 4: Combination and Testing

Once the control panel was constructed, the combination phase started. The group made sure a smooth connection in between Power BI and the data sources, enabling automated data revitalizes. Rigorous testing was carried out to recognize and correct any disparities or efficiency concerns.


Step 5: Training and Rollout


To assist in user adoption, extensive training sessions were organized for stakeholders. Training products, consisting of user manuals and guide videos, were offered to improve understanding and engagement. Following a pilot stage, feedback was gathered, prompting minor improvements before the last rollout.



Outcomes

The Power BI dashboard was formally launched 3 months post-initiation, and the outcomes were tangible:



Improved Decision-Making: Stakeholders reported quicker access to crucial data points, which considerably improved the speed of decision-making procedures.
Enhanced Sales Performance: The sales team had the ability to determine underperforming items quickly and adjust marketing techniques accordingly, resulting in a 15% boost in sales within six months of the dashboard implementation.
User Adoption: With 90% of the targeted user base actively engaging with the dashboard, the business experienced a cultural shift towards data-driven decision-making.
Cost Efficiency: Automation of reports lessened manual data processing time, enabling staff members to concentrate on tactical efforts rather than administrative tasks.

Conclusion

The Power BI dashboard development project at Retail Innovations Inc. serves as a testimony to the transformative power of data visualization tools in driving business insights. By buying an easy to use, scalable, and informative dashboard, the business not only streamlined its data analysis procedures but likewise promoted a culture of informed decision-making. This case study highlights the value of lining up business intelligence tools with organizational objectives, eventually boosting the ability to react to market characteristics effectively. As businesses continue to navigate a significantly complex landscape, such efforts will be important for continual growth and competitiveness.
